Output 642ecd74e8d5622e8340f1aae4137a0de29c07dee21d23e46fa2bb1fda0f21af:1

value
635960
script pubkey
OP_0 OP_PUSHBYTES_20 905c8e075d746579fb5ff946906d124344ca6edb
address
ltc1qjpwgup6aw3jhn76ll9rfqmgjgdzv5mkmjnm7qj
transaction
642ecd74e8d5622e8340f1aae4137a0de29c07dee21d23e46fa2bb1fda0f21af
spent
true